Human cells have 23 distinct types of chromosomes, including the 22 autosomes and the X or Y sex chromosome. (The autosomes are usually paired and are the same in both sexes.) You inherit one of each type from each of your parents so that the typical human somatic cell has 46 chromosomes. (Sperm and egg cells, of course, have 23 each.) While there is no difference in the 44 autosomnal chromosomes by sex, the sex chromosomes are paired XX in a woman and XY in a man.

What can be used to determine if a person has inherited the normal number of chromosomes?

Karyotyping, which involves examining a person's chromosomes under a microscope, is commonly used to determine if an individual has the normal number of chromosomes. This process can identify any abnormalities or extra/missing chromosomes that may be present in an individual's genetic makeup.

Why do reproductive cells need to have half the normal number of chromosomes?

Humans and other organisms that reproduce sexually need to have half the normal number of chromosomes to make sure their offspring have the same number of chromosomes as they do - the father and mother each contribute half of their chromosomes (sperm and egg).
